Title: Snoop Dogg on Method Man's new album
Post by: davida.b. on February 27, 2004, 04:55:57 PM
Tentative Tracklisting:



1. "Rza Intro" (Produced by Rza)

2. "Da Intro" (Produced by Rick Rock)

3. "Say What" feat. Missy Elliott" (Produced by P. Diddy and Dofat)

4. "What's Happenin feat. Busta Rhymes" (Produced by Scratchator)

5. "The Motto" (Produced by Nasheim Myrick)

6. "We Some Dogs" feat. Redman and Snoop Dogg (Produced by Denaun Porter)

7. "The Turn" feat. Raekwon (Produced by Rza)

8. "Tease" feat. Chinky (Produced by No I.D.)

9. "Mef Kids skit" (Produced by Method Man)

10. "Never Hold Back" feat. Saukrates and E3 (Produced by E3)

11. "Rodeo" feat. Ludacris (Produced by Jahmal Gwin)

12. "Baby Come On" feat. Kardinal Official (Produced by Fafu)

13. "Ain't A Damn Thing Changed" feat. O.D.B. (Produced by Jellyroll)

14. "Black Ice Interlude" (Produced by Dofat)

15. "Crooked Letter I" feat. Streetlife (Produced by Denuan Porter)

16. "The Show" (Produced by Self)

17. "Afterparty" featuring GhostFace (Produced by Quran Goodman)

18. "Act Right" (Produced by Rockwilder)
